WebJan 2, 2024 · Brokers who are registering for the first time must apply for broker authority with the FMCSA via the Unified Registration System and get assigned an MC number. This … WebFeb 28, 2024 · All licensed freight brokers must have a bond of at least $75,000 in place, but the expense of securing the bond is only a fraction of this amount. Freight broker bonds cost Between 1% and 12% of the total bond amount in most cases. That's an up-front cost of $750 to $9,000. The surety company offering a freight broker bond determines the ...

When … dying in the hospitalWebMar 20, 2024 · The Ultimate Secret Of FREIGHT BROKER AND TRUCKING BUSINESS STARTUP- 2 Books in 1:Step-by-Step Guide to Start your own Freight Brokerage Business … dying in the sun lyricsWebDec 30, 2024 · A freight broker assists shipping companies to move products from one point to the other. Instead of doing the job themselves, the broker finds a trucking company to haul the cargo. While doing so, the broker ensures that the trucking company will charge less than the shipping company is willing to pay. In this way, they make a profit.
